Compare and contrast a daily forecast and a long-range forecast.

A daily forecast and a long-range forecast are two types of weather forecasts that provide different timeframes and levels of detail. Here are the main ways in which they compare and contrast:

1. Timeframe: The most significant difference between a daily forecast and a long-range forecast is the timeframe they cover. A daily forecast typically provides weather information for the next 24 to 36 hours, while a long-range forecast extends the prediction to several weeks, months, or even seasons ahead.

2. Detail: Daily forecasts offer more detailed weather information for specific locations and provide hourly predictions for temperature, precipitation, wind speed, and other relevant factors. On the other hand, long-range forecasts provide broader trends and general patterns, such as expected temperature ranges or chances of above or below average precipitation.

3. Accuracy: Daily forecasts are generally more accurate than long-range forecasts. Weather conditions can change rapidly within a 24-hour period, and meteorologists rely on real-time data and models to provide precise predictions. Long-range forecasts, due to the inherent complexity of weather patterns and the absence of detailed real-time data, are more probabilistic in nature and carry a higher degree of uncertainty.

4. Application: Daily forecasts are widely used for short-term planning, such as deciding on appropriate clothing, scheduling outdoor activities, or making travel arrangements. Long-range forecasts, on the other hand, are utilized for broader planning purposes like farming decisions, construction projects, or seasonal business strategies.

5. Impact: Due to their shorter timeframe and higher accuracy, daily forecasts have a more immediate impact on people's daily lives and activities. They help individuals make real-time decisions based on the current and upcoming weather conditions. Long-range forecasts, despite being less accurate, allow for preparedness and mitigation of potential risks associated with weather conditions that might unfold weeks or months ahead.

In summary, daily and long-range forecasts differ in terms of timeframe, level of detail, accuracy, application, and impact. While daily forecasts are more precise and actionable for short-term decision-making, long-range forecasts provide a broader outlook for strategic planning, even though they carry a higher degree of uncertainty.
